数据库中的转储和恢复
数据库转储与恢复:全方位数据安全与恢复策略
在信息化时代,数据库作为企业核心资产,其稳定性和安全性至关重要。数据库的转储和恢复是保障数据安全、应对突发事件的关键措施。本文将全方位数据库转储与恢复的相关知识,帮助您掌握数据安全与恢复策略。
一、数据库转储
1.什么是数据库转储?
数据库转储是指将数据库中的数据备份到另一个存储介质上的过程。转储的主要目的是为了防止数据丢失、损坏或被篡改,确保在发生故障时能够快速恢复。
2.数据库转储的类型
(1)完全转储:将整个数据库的数据和结构备份到另一个存储介质上。
(2)部分转储:只备份数据库中的部分数据或结构。
(3)增量转储:只备份自上次转储以来发生变化的数据。
3.数据库转储的方法
(1)物理转储:通过复制数据库文件来实现转储。
(2)逻辑转储:通过SQL语句将数据导出到另一个存储介质上。
二、数据库恢复
1.什么是数据库恢复?
数据库恢复是指将备份的数据重新加载到数据库中的过程。恢复的目的是为了使数据库恢复到故障前的状态。
2.数据库恢复的类型

(1)完全恢复:将整个数据库恢复到故障前的状态。
(2)部分恢复:只恢复数据库中的部分数据或结构。
(3)增量恢复:只恢复自上次转储以来发生变化的数据。
3.数据库恢复的方法
(1)物理恢复:通过复制备份的数据库文件来实现恢复。
(2)逻辑恢复:通过执行备份时的SQL语句来实现恢复。
三、数据库转储与恢复的策略
1.定期转储:根据业务需求和数据库大小,制定合理的转储周期,确保数据安全。
2.多级转储:采用多级转储策略,如每天进行完全转储,每周进行增量转储,每月进行部分转储。
3.异地备份:将备份存储在异地,以防止自然灾害等突发事件导致数据丢失。
4.验证恢复:定期进行恢复测试,确保备份的有效性和恢复的可行性。
5.权限管理:严格控制数据库转储和恢复的权限,防止未授权操作。

四、数据库转储与恢复的注意事项
1.选择合适的转储工具:根据数据库类型和业务需求,选择合适的转储工具。
2.优化转储策略:根据数据库特点和业务需求,优化转储策略,提高转储效率。
3.合理分配存储空间:预留足够的存储空间用于转储和恢复。
4.定期检查备份:定期检查备份的有效性和完整性,确保数据安全。
5.培训相关人员:对数据库管理员进行转储和恢复方面的培训,提高其应对突发事件的能力。
数据库转储和恢复是保障数据安全、应对突发事件的关键措施。通过掌握数据库转储与恢复的相关知识,制定合理的策略,可以有效提高数据安全性和恢复能力。在实际应用中,还需注意选择合适的工具、优化策略和加强培训,以确保数据库安全稳定运行。